FORT is excited to announce that we have partnered with OpenJAUS to integrate native support for the RAS-G Interoperability Profile into our latest custom control solution. This milestone brings FORT's safety-certified technology directly into the IOP ecosystem and opens up new pathways for customers in defense and government programs.
We're excited to announce that FORT has acquired Mapless AI, a leader in vehicle teleoperation and autonomy supervision. The acquisition brings new capabilities to the FORT platform including remote teleoperation and onboard active safety, giving our customers more solutions for deploying autonomous machines safely in the real world. We're excited to announce that FORT is partnering with Advantech to bring integrated functional safety to their new MIC-735 edge AI system, powered by the NVIDIA IGX Thor platform. This collaboration embeds FORT's safety architecture directly into a production-ready edge AI inference system built for real-world robotics and AMR deployments.
